vendor/assets/javascripts/groundworkcss/components/equalizeColumns.js in groundworkcss-rails-0.2.9 vs vendor/assets/javascripts/groundworkcss/components/equalizeColumns.js in groundworkcss-rails-0.2.10
- old
+ new
@@ -1,34 +1,37 @@
-// Generated by CoffeeScript 1.6.1
-var equalizeColumns;
+(function() {
+ var equalizeColumns;
-$(window).load(function() {
- return equalizeColumns();
-});
+ $(window).load(function() {
+ return equalizeColumns();
+ });
-$(window).resize(function() {
- return equalizeColumns();
-});
+ $(window).resize(function() {
+ return equalizeColumns();
+ });
-equalizeColumns = function() {
- return $('.row.equalize').each(function() {
- var $row, collapsed, tallest;
- $row = $(this);
- tallest = 0;
- collapsed = false;
- $(this).children('*').each(function(i) {
- $(this).css('min-height', '1px');
- collapsed = $(this).outerWidth() === $row.outerWidth();
- if (!collapsed) {
- if (!$(this).hasClass('equal')) {
- $(this).addClass('equal');
+ equalizeColumns = function() {
+ return $('.row.equalize').each(function() {
+ var $row, collapsed, tallest;
+
+ $row = $(this);
+ tallest = 0;
+ collapsed = false;
+ $(this).children('*').each(function(i) {
+ $(this).css('min-height', '1px');
+ collapsed = $(this).outerWidth() === $row.outerWidth();
+ if (!collapsed) {
+ if (!$(this).hasClass('equal')) {
+ $(this).addClass('equal');
+ }
+ if ($(this).outerHeight() > tallest) {
+ return tallest = $(this).outerHeight();
+ }
}
- if ($(this).outerHeight() > tallest) {
- return tallest = $(this).outerHeight();
- }
+ });
+ if (!collapsed) {
+ return $(this).children('*').css('min-height', tallest);
}
});
- if (!collapsed) {
- return $(this).children('*').css('min-height', tallest);
- }
- });
-};
+ };
+
+}).call(this);